What Is an AI Image Translator?
AI image translator is an intelligent tool that identifies text in images and translates it to another language as a result of machine learning models.
It is a combination of three technologies:
- Optical Character Recognition (OCR) – Detects and extracts text from an image.
- Neural Machine Translation (NMT) – Translates extracted text into the target language.
- Context Understanding – Ensures the translation fits naturally with the image’s context and tone.
In short, it’s like pointing your camera at an image written in another language — and watching it instantly appear in your language.
How AI Image Translation Works
The process behind AI image translation is seamless yet sophisticated:
- Upload or Capture Image – A user uploads a photo (like a document or sign).
- AI Detection – The system identifies areas containing text.
- Text Extraction – OCR reads the text pixel by pixel.
- Translation Engine – The detected text is sent to a neural network that understands grammar, meaning, and tone.
- Reconstruction – The translated text is placed back into the image, matching fonts and alignment for a natural look.
The result? A perfectly translated version of the image — as if it was originally written in your language.
